JavaScript-те объектісін for-in циклымен қарап шығу
Объектілерді қарап шығу үшін
for-in циклі арнайы жасалған.
Оның синтаксисі келесідей:
for (let кілтУшінАйнымалы in объект) {
}
кілтУшінАйнымалы-ге кезек-кезек
қарапылып отырған объектінің кілттері түседі.
Бір мысалда көрейік.
Бізде мынадай объект бар делік:
let obj = {a: 1, b: 2, c: 3};
for-in циклін қолданып осы объектінің
кілттерін шығарайық:
for (let key in obj) {
console.log(key); // 'a', 'b', 'c' шығарады
}
Енді элементтерді шығарайық:
for (let key in obj) {
console.log(obj[key]); // 1, 2, 3 шығарады
}
Келесі объектінің барлық кілттерін консольге шығарыңыз:
let obj = {x: 1, y: 2, z: 3};
Келесі объектінің барлық элементтерін консольге шығарыңыз:
let obj = {x: 1, y: 2, z: 3};